The Opportunity
The People Analytics & Insights Manager is responsible for transforming workforce data into actionable insights that inform and direct business decisions across Valvoline and Valvoline Instant Oil Change (VIOC). This role partners closely with Reporting & Compliance and HR leaders to move beyond reporting toward insight-driven decision making, with a strong emphasis on employee listening and analytics enablement at scale.
How You’ll Make an Impact
- Partner closely with Reporting & Compliance to ensure data accuracy, consistency, governance, and compliance while translating reports into meaningful insights for leaders.
- Analyze workforce data to identify trends, risks, and opportunities related to retention, engagement, staffing, performance, and workforce health.
- Develop business-relevant insights that connect people metrics to operational and financial outcomes, particularly within high-volume, frontline environments.
- Serve as a thought partner to HRBPs and business leaders, helping them interpret data and apply insights to workforce decisions.
- Own and manage the employee listening strategy using Workday Peakon, including survey design, administration, driver analysis, and insight generation.
- Enable leaders with clear, practical survey results and guidance to support action planning and sustained improvement.
- Create executive-ready dashboards, summaries, and narratives that clearly articulate “what’s happening,” “why it matters,” and “what to do next.”
- Establish and maintain standard people metrics while allowing flexibility for business-specific insights.
- Continuously improve analytics capability by identifying opportunities to enhance tools, processes, and data literacy across HR.
- Support enterprise and functional readouts (e.g., HRLT, business reviews, SteerCo) as needed.
What You’ll Bring
- Bachelor’s degree required (Human Resources, Analytics, Business, Data Science, or related field preferred)
- 5+ years of experience in people analytics, workforce analytics, HR analytics, or a related discipline
- Demonstrated experience translating data into insights that influence business decisions
- Strong analytical skills with the ability to synthesize quantitative and qualitative data
- Experience working with HR systems and analytics platforms; Workday and/or Peakon experience preferred
- Experience with HR data tools such as Workday Prism preferred
- Ability to communicate complex data in clear, compelling ways to non-technical audiences
- Comfort operating in a fast-paced, evolving environment with multiple stakeholders
- Strong partnership mindset with the ability to influence without authority
- Utilize advanced Excel features (such as PivotTables, Power Pivot, XLOOKUP/INDEX MATCH, and Power Query) and SQL to extract, clean, and analyze large-scale HR data
- Create executive-level dashboards using strong design principles to present clear, actionable insights
- Must be authorized to work in the U.S.
